Development of Students’ Feelings of National Pride, National Honor, And National Identity Awareness

National pride, national identity, youth educationAbstract
This article analyzes the key aspects of forming and developing students’ sense of national pride, national dignity, and national identity awareness. It examines the role of national values, traditions, and spiritual heritage in the educational process, as well as their impact on young people’s consciousness. The study also highlights effective pedagogical approaches aimed at strengthening high spirituality, patriotism, and loyalty to one’s identity among the younger generation.
